On AWS, a network interface can get reinitialized every 30 minutes due
to the MTU being (re)set when a new DHCP lease is obtained.
If DHCP works for you instead of SYNCDHCP, you won't have to worry about the MTU bug. There seems to be some misconception regarding the difference between SYNCDHCP and DHCP. The only thing SYNCDHCP does differently with regards to DHCP is that the boot scripts stop and wait for the interface to actually get an IP address before continuing the boot process. It does NOT change how dhclient(8) operates. A 'regular' DHCP simply starts dhclient(8) in the background and doesn't wait for the interface to actually receive anything. This could potentially cause problems with services getting started before the interface has an IP address.

Back to the original question. The first place I start when I have ethernet problems is to turn on debugging for the interface.
This is done via the sysctl function. You need to find the correct area to add the debug setting.
I would start with sysctl -a |grep ena_sysctl
If that is the correct location then add a sysctl for debugging:
sysctl ena_sysctl.0.debug=1
Then your /var/log/debug.log should show the problem.
You might also want to look at your /var/log/messages and /var/log/devd.log for clues.
